Find flights
Airlines

C$ 307+ Cheap flights to Oslo

This is the cheapest one-way flight price found by a Cheapflights user in the last 72 hours by searching for a flight departing on 19/3. Fares are subject to change and may not be available on all flights or dates of travel.
— OSL
25 Feb — 4 Mar1
1 adult

Flights to Oslo in 2025

Find the latest flights to Oslo in 2025, with up-to-date prices and availability. In the last 7 days, Cheapflights users made a total of 629,999 searches and data was last updated on 20 February 2025.

Round-trip from

C$ 860

One-way from

C$ 307

Popular in

December

Cheapest in

May

Average price

C$ 1,004
23/3-8/4
  • 23/3-8/4
  • 3 total stops
  • 43h 20m total
  • Toronto to Oslo
19/3
  • 19/3
  • 1 total stop
  • 21h 45m total
  • Toronto to Oslo
Highest demand for flights based on searches. 1% potential increase in price (C$ 19 potential increase over avg. RT price).
Cheapest flight prices on average. 1% potential price decrease (C$ 31 potential savings vs. average RT price).
Average for round-trip flights in February 2025

Find flight deals to Oslo

Cheapest flights to Oslo
Explore the most affordable flight options available to Oslo. Find the lowest fares based on data from user searches, with prices last updated on 20 February 2025.

Sun 23/37:20 p.m.YHM - OSL
2 stops14h 05mMultiple Airlines
Tue 8/46:30 p.m.OSL - YHM
1 stop29h 15mMultiple Airlines
Deal found 20/2C$ 860
Mon 5/510:45 p.m.YYZ - OSL
1 stop19h 10mMultiple Airlines
Thu 15/54:35 p.m.OSL - YYZ
1 stop27h 35mMultiple Airlines
Deal found 19/2C$ 884
Sun 13/45:10 p.m.YYZ - OSL
1 stop11h 10mScandinavian Airlines
Wed 23/48:55 p.m.OSL - YYZ
1 stop24h 45mScandinavian Airlines
Deal found 18/2C$ 950
Wed 26/38:45 p.m.YYZ - OSL
1 stop9h 50mIcelandair
Fri 4/41:50 p.m.OSL - YYZ
1 stop11h 20mIcelandair
Deal found 18/2C$ 953
Sun 23/39:30 p.m.YYZ - OSL
1 stop15h 45mSWISS
Wed 9/45:40 a.m.OSL - YYZ
1 stop16h 40mSWISS
Deal found 18/2C$ 987
Thu 22/58:20 p.m.YYZ - OSL
1 stop12h 25mAir Canada
Mon 2/67:15 a.m.OSL - YYZ
1 stop13h 45mAir Canada
Deal found 19/2C$ 996
Sun 2/39:15 p.m.YYZ - OSL
1 stop17h 35mKLM
Fri 7/35:00 p.m.OSL - YYZ
1 stop28h 40mKLM
Deal found 19/2C$ 999
Mon 31/35:50 p.m.YYZ - OSL
1 stop18h 15mLufthansa
Sat 5/46:55 p.m.OSL - YYZ
1 stop25h 45mLufthansa
Deal found 18/2C$ 1,009
Mon 5/55:10 p.m.YYZ - TRF
1 stop15h 10mScandinavian Airlines
Thu 15/52:55 p.m.TRF - YYZ
1 stop30h 45mScandinavian Airlines
Deal found 19/2C$ 1,012
Fri 21/26:35 p.m.YYZ - OSL
1 stop15h 25mDelta
Fri 28/26:30 a.m.OSL - YYZ
2 stops15h 39mDelta
Deal found 18/2C$ 1,031
Thu 22/56:35 p.m.YYZ - OSL
1 stop16h 40mBrussels Airlines
Mon 2/66:45 a.m.OSL - YYZ
2 stops38h 05mBrussels Airlines
Deal found 19/2C$ 1,061
Sun 2/36:15 a.m.YYZ - OSL
2 stops29h 40mUnited Airlines
Sun 30/37:15 a.m.OSL - YYZ
2 stops30h 49mUnited Airlines
Deal found 18/2C$ 1,068

Find flights to Oslo within your budget

Locate flights to Oslo that fit your budget, with regularly updated fares and availability. In the last 7 days, Cheapflights users made a total of 629,999 searches and data was last updated on 20 February 2025.

Fly from

Toronto

Route

Depart

Return

Price

HamiltonOslo

YHM - OSL

YHMOSL

Hamilton

Sun 23/3

7:20 p.m.-2:25 p.m.

2 stops14h 05m

Oslo Gardermoen

Tue 8/4

6:30 p.m.-5:45 p.m.

1 stop29h 15m

C$ 860

TorontoOslo

YYZ - OSL

YYZOSL

Toronto Pearson Intl

Mon 5/5

10:45 p.m.-11:55 p.m.

1 stop19h 10m

Oslo Gardermoen

Thu 15/5

4:35 p.m.-2:10 p.m.

1 stop27h 35m

C$ 884

TorontoOslo

YYZ - OSL

YYZOSL

Toronto Pearson Intl

Sun 13/4

5:10 p.m.-10:20 a.m.

1 stop11h 10m

Oslo Gardermoen

Wed 23/4

8:55 p.m.-3:40 p.m.

1 stop24h 45m

C$ 950

TorontoOslo

YYZ - OSL

YYZOSL

Toronto Pearson Intl

Wed 26/3

8:45 p.m.-11:35 a.m.

1 stop9h 50m

Oslo Gardermoen

Fri 4/4

1:50 p.m.-7:10 p.m.

1 stop11h 20m

C$ 953

TorontoOslo

YYZ - OSL

YYZOSL

Toronto Pearson Intl

Sun 23/3

9:30 p.m.-6:15 p.m.

1 stop15h 45m

Oslo Gardermoen

Wed 9/4

5:40 a.m.-4:20 p.m.

1 stop16h 40m

C$ 987

TorontoOslo

YYZ - OSL

YYZOSL

Toronto Pearson Intl

Thu 22/5

8:20 p.m.-2:45 p.m.

1 stop12h 25m

Oslo Gardermoen

Mon 2/6

7:15 a.m.-3:00 p.m.

1 stop13h 45m

C$ 996

TorontoOslo

YYZ - OSL

YYZOSL

Toronto Pearson Intl

Sun 2/3

9:15 p.m.-8:50 p.m.

1 stop17h 35m

Oslo Gardermoen

Fri 7/3

5:00 p.m.-3:40 p.m.

1 stop28h 40m

C$ 999

TorontoOslo

YTZ - OSL

YTZOSL

Toronto Island

Fri 21/3

5:25 p.m.-4:00 p.m.

2 stops17h 35m

Oslo Gardermoen

Fri 28/3

6:00 a.m.-9:50 p.m.

2 stops20h 50m

C$ 1,000

TorontoOslo

YYZ - OSL

YYZOSL

Toronto Pearson Intl

Mon 31/3

5:50 p.m.-6:05 p.m.

1 stop18h 15m

Oslo Gardermoen

Thu 3/4

6:55 p.m.-2:40 p.m.

1 stop25h 45m

C$ 1,009

TorontoOslo

YYZ - TRF

YYZTRF

Toronto Pearson Intl

Mon 5/5

5:10 p.m.-2:20 p.m.

1 stop15h 10m

Oslo Sandefjord

Thu 15/5

2:55 p.m.-3:40 p.m.

1 stop30h 45m

C$ 1,012

Flights are sorted by cheapest round-trip flights first.

Deals found on 19/2

Showing 1-10 of 29 results
1
2
3

Best time to book a flight to Oslo

Have a flexible travel schedule? Discover the best time to fly to Oslo with our price prediction graph.
Estimated round-trip price
Rates are based on past data. Find the cheapest month and day to book your flight based on your travel requirements, then search for cheap deals.

Travel insights for flights to Oslo

Get recent, data-driven insights about flights to Oslo including ideal travel times, pricing trends, and more.

When is the best time to book a flight to Oslo?

Use this chart to determine the optimal time to book a round-trip flight from Toronto to Oslo. Price data was last updated on 14 February 2025.

To ensure you get the cheapest price possible for a flight to Oslo, you should look to book at least 70 days in advance of your intended travel date. The price of your flight may increase if you delay and leave booking until a week or so before departure.

How long is the flight to Oslo?

On average, a flight from Toronto to Oslo takes 13 hours 15 minutes. Flights to Oslo from other popular cities in Canada will vary in length. Below are a few examples of popular routes and their flight times.

What are the cheapest airlines that fly to Oslo?

The cheapest airlines flying from Toronto to Oslo are Delta, Lufthansa and Icelandair.

Rainfall in Oslo by month

Plan your trip to Oslo by taking into account the average rainfall totals by month.

In terms of precipitation, rainfall in Oslo ranges from 40.0 - 90.0 mm per month. August is typically the wettest month, when rainfall can reach 90.0 mm. February is typically the driest time to visit Oslo when rainfall is around 40.0 mm.

Temperature in Oslo by month

Plan your trip to Oslo by taking into account the average temperature totals by month.

If weather is an important factor for your trip to Oslo, use this chart to help with planning. For those seeking warmer temperatures, July is the ideal time of year to visit, when temperatures reach an average of 17.0 C. Travellers hoping to avoid the cold should look outside of January, when temperatures are typically at their lowest (around -3.0 C).

Reviews of airlines servicing Oslo

Get insights into the airlines that provide service to Oslo. Read reviews, discover amenities, and learn about the overall travel experience offered by airlines. Use this information to make informed decisions when choosing an airline for your flight to Oslo. Reviews last updated 20 February 2025.
Read through reviews of airlines servicing Oslo, such as KLM, Finnair and Azores Airlines. Users can see the overall rating for each airline as well as how each is rated in terms of entertainment options, comfort, food, crew/service, and boarding process.

Entertainment

7.2

Boarding

7.8

Comfort

7.7

Food

7.3

Crew

8.4

Overall

7.8

Reviews

1 / 20

8.0
Excellent

Anonymous,Dec 2024

YWG - YYZ

I could not select a seat prior to check in as systems not integrated. Different PNRs should be on reservation which would make process easier.

Entertainment

7.2

Boarding

7.8

Comfort

7.7

Food

7.3

Crew

8.4

Overall

7.8

Reviews

1 / 20

8.0
Excellent

Anonymous,Dec 2024

YWG - YYZ

I could not select a seat prior to check in as systems not integrated. Different PNRs should be on reservation which would make process easier.

Entertainment

7.2

Boarding

7.8

Comfort

7.7

Food

7.3

Crew

8.4

Overall

7.8

Reviews

1 / 20

8.0
Excellent

Anonymous,Dec 2024

YWG - YYZ

I could not select a seat prior to check in as systems not integrated. Different PNRs should be on reservation which would make process easier.

Entertainment

7.2

Boarding

7.8

Comfort

7.7

Food

7.3

Crew

8.4

Overall

7.8

Reviews

1 / 20

8.0
Excellent

Anonymous,Dec 2024

YWG - YYZ

I could not select a seat prior to check in as systems not integrated. Different PNRs should be on reservation which would make process easier.

Entertainment

7.2

Boarding

7.8

Comfort

7.7

Food

7.3

Crew

8.4

Overall

7.8

Reviews

1 / 20

8.0
Excellent

Anonymous,Dec 2024

YWG - YYZ

I could not select a seat prior to check in as systems not integrated. Different PNRs should be on reservation which would make process easier.

Entertainment

7.2

Boarding

7.8

Comfort

7.7

Food

7.3

Crew

8.4

Overall

7.8

Reviews

1 / 20

8.0
Excellent

Anonymous,Dec 2024

YWG - YYZ

I could not select a seat prior to check in as systems not integrated. Different PNRs should be on reservation which would make process easier.

  • Can I find cheaper flights to Oslo if I am willing to have layovers?

    Yes, flights with layovers are often cheaper than direct flights. Keep an eye out for flight deals to Oslo on Cheapflights that require 1 or 2 stops for potential cost savings.

  • What is the best airline to fly to Oslo?

    Based on reviews from Cheapflights users, Delta is rated the highest out of the airlines that fly to Oslo.

  • How much is a round-trip flight to Oslo?

    A round-trip flight to Oslo will typically cost around C$ 157, however they can be found for as little as C$ 108.

  • Where does the fastest flight to Oslo depart from?

    For those looking to save time traveling to Oslo, Toronto offers the quickest one-way flight (9 hours 50 minutes).

  • Does Oslo Gardermoen have rental cars?

    Yes. Those touching down at Oslo Gardermoen can take advantage of the rental car services offered upon their arrival.

  • Are there hotels close to Oslo Gardermoen?

    Yes. Oslo Gardermoen has hotels nearby for those requiring accommodations. Radisson Blu Airport Hotel, Oslo Gardermoen is the closest property to Oslo Gardermoen (0.0 km away from Oslo Gardermoen).

See more FAQs

Browse thousands of different options on Cheapflights for your next trip

Toggle through the tabs below to find thousands of options on Cheapflights for your next trip.

Airports serving Oslo

Book a flight to or from one of these Oslo airports.

Fly with Cheapflights

Find the best flight deals on Cheapflights, where travelers can enjoy low prices and a wide availability of flights to their desired destinations.

How does Cheapflights help users find flights to Oslo?

Cheapflights helps you search for flights to Oslo via 900+ travel sites so you don’t have to. After performing a flight search, users can also filter their flight selection by filtering for price, number of stops, airlines, and so on.

Why should you use Cheapflights to find cheap flight tickets to Oslo?

By finding flights from multiple airlines and providers at completely no cost, Cheapflights helps millions of users like you annually find the best flights to Oslo.

Can Cheapflights find flights to Oslo with no change fees?

Cheapflights does show flights with no change fees to all users. To see these options for flights to Oslo, users can toggle the no change fees filter when performing a flight search.

Can Cheapflights notify me if prices for flights to Oslo become cheaper?

Yes, and it’s super simple to set up Price Alerts. Click the bell icon next to the flight deals above and provide your email address. That’s it!

100% Free
Cheapflights is completely free to use, so you can start saving the moment you arrive.
Book with Flexibility
Our users can plan ahead with confidence and find flights with no change fees
Travel Smart
Millions of people come to us for their flight needs every year. We help make travel planning easy by providing useful insights and data-driven graphs that can inform your decisions.